Почему Excel не сохраняет документ: полный разбор причин

При попытке нажать комбинацию Ctrl+S или выбрать соответствующий пункт в меню пользователь часто сталкивается с полным отсутствием реакции программы или появлением системного сообщения об ошибке, блокирующего дальнейшие действия. Сбой сохранения может быть вызван критическим переполнением оперативной памяти, повреждением временных файлов кэша или конфликтом версий при синхронизации через облачные хранилища. В некоторых случаях система безопасности Windows блокирует запись изменений на диск, если у пользователя отсутствуют необходимые права администратора или файл помечен как «только для чтения».

Важно сразу обратить внимание на текст ошибки, если он появляется на экране, так как код сообщения часто указывает на конкретный модуль Microsoft Excel, который не справляется с задачей. Игнорирование первых симптомов может привести к полной потере данных, поэтому необходимо последовательно проверить настройки автосохранения и состояние дискового пространства. Ниже представлен детальный алгоритм диагностики и устранения неполадок, охватывающий как программные сбои, так и аппаратные ограничения.

Проблемы с правами доступа и атрибутами файла

Наиболее банальной, но часто встречающейся причиной невозможности записать изменения является блокировка файла операционной системой. Если документ был скачан из интернета, получен по электронной почте или скопирован с другого компьютера, Windows может автоматически установить атрибут «Только для чтения» в целях безопасности. В этом случае программа позволяет открыть файл и даже редактировать его содержимое, но при попытке сохранить изменения поверх оригинала выдает предупреждение или предлагает создать копию с новым именем.

Также стоит проверить, не открыт ли данный файл в режиме совместного доступа другими пользователями локальной сети. Excel имеет механизм блокировки файлов при редактировании, чтобы предотвратить конфликты версий. Если кто-то другой уже работает с документом, ваша копия будет доступна только для чтения, пока владелец не закроет файл. Кроме того, антивирусное программное обеспечение может в реальном времени сканировать действия программы и блокировать запись, если поведение приложения покажется ему подозр.

  • 🔒 Проверьте свойства файла через контекстное меню и снимите галочку «Только для чтения».
  • 👥 Убедитесь, что файл не заблокирован другим пользователем в сетевой папке.
  • 🛡️ Временно отключите антивирус для проверки его влияния на процесс сохранения.
  • 💾 Попробуйте сохранить копию документа в другую папку с полными правами доступа.

⚠️ Внимание: Если файл находится в системной папке Windows (например, Program Files), у вас может не быть прав на запись даже при наличии прав администратора. Всегда сохраняйте рабочие документы в папку «Документы» или на рабочий стол.

Как быстро снять блокировку с файла

Откройте «Проводник», найдите файл, нажмите правой кнопкой мыши → «Свойства». Внизу вкладки «Общие» снимите флажок «Только для чтения» и нажмите «ОК».

Переполнение памяти и лимиты ресурсов Excel

Современные версии табличного процессора, такие как Excel 2019 или Microsoft 365, способны обрабатывать огромные массивы данных, но они не лишены ограничений. Если ваш документ содержит миллионы строк, тысячи сложных формул или тяжелые графические объекты, доступная оперативная память (RAM) может быть исчерпана. В момент сохранения программе требуется дополнительный буфер для временного хранения данных, и если свободных ресурсов нет, процесс прерывается.

Особенно критична ситуация для 32-битных версий Office, которые не могут адресовать более 2 ГБ оперативной памяти независимо от того, сколько RAM установлено в компьютере. Переполнение памяти часто приводит не только к отказу сохранения, но и к полному зависанию интерфейса. В логах событий Windows в этот момент могут появляться ошибки, связанные с нехваткой виртуальной памяти.

📊 Какая у вас версия Excel?
32-битная
64-битная
Не знаю
Office 365 (облачная)

Для решения проблемы рекомендуется закрыть другие тяжелые приложения, освободив ресурсы системы. Если документ действительно слишком велик, стоит рассмотреть возможность разделения его на несколько меньших файлов или оптимизации формул. Переход на 64-битную версию Office также является эффективным способом устранения лимитов адресации памяти.

Конфликты надстроек и сторонних плагинов

Расширяемость Microsoft Excel является одним из его главных преимуществ, но установленные надстройки (Add-ins) часто становятся источником нестабильности. Сторонние плагины для работы с бухгалтерией, макросы или инструменты интеграции с CRM-системами могут внедрять свои hooks (крюки) в процесс сохранения файла. Если код надстройки содержит ошибки или несовместим с текущей версией программы, он может блокировать штатную процедуру записи данных на диск.

Диагностика этой проблемы требует запуска программы в безопасном режиме, который отключает все дополнительные модули. Для этого необходимо зажать клавишу Ctrl при запуске ярлыка Excel или использовать команду excel /safe. Если в безопасном режиме документ сохраняется успешно, значит, проблема кроется именно в одном из установленных расширений.

☑️ Диагностика надстроек

Выполнено: 0 / 4

После выявления конфликтующего плагина его следует обновить до последней версии или полностью удалить через меню управления надстройками. Часто разработчики выпускают патчи, исправляющие совместимость с новыми обновлениями Windows или самого Office.

Ошибки синхронизации OneDrive и сетевых хранилищ

При работе с файлами, расположенными в облачных хранилищах like OneDrive, Dropbox или сетевых папках, процесс сохранения становится двухэтапным: сначала данные записываются в локальный кэш, а затем синхронизируются с сервером. Если интернет-соединение нестабильно или сервер перегружен, Excel может зависнуть в ожидании подтверждения от сервиса синхронизации. В интерфейсе это часто выглядит как бесконечный процесс сохранения или сообщение «Файл заблокирован для редактирования».

Кроме того, если версия файла в облаке и локальная версия имеют конфликтующие изменения, система может заблокировать запись, чтобы избежать потери данных. В таких случаях полезно проверить статус синхронизации в трее Windows и убедиться, что клиент OneDrive работает корректно. Иногда помогает временное отключение функции «Автосохранение» в левом верхнем углу окна программы.

Симптом Вероятная причина Действие
Файл сохранен как копия Конфликт версий в облаке Проверить историю версий в OneDrive
Долгое ожидание Отсутствие сети Сохранить локально в другую папку
Ошибка доступа Неверные учетные данные Выйти и войти в аккаунт заново
Файл помечен как «Только чтение» Блокировка сервером Закрыть файл в других устройствах

Повреждение файла и необходимость восстановления

Если документ перестал сохраняться внезапно, без изменения настроек системы, высока вероятность повреждения внутренней структуры файла. Формат .xlsx представляет собой архив XML-файлов, и повреждение даже одного небольшого элемента может сделать файл нечитаемым или недоступным для записи. Это часто случается после некорректного завершения работы компьютера, скачков напряжения или вирусов.

Встроенный механизм восстановления Excel может помочь вернуть доступ к данным. При открытии файла выберите опцию «Открыть и восстановить». Также существует метод открытия файла через сторонние программы, такие как LibreOffice Calc или онлайн-сервис Google Таблицы, которые могут игнорировать некоторые ошибки структуры и позволить сохранить документ в новом, чистом формате.

⚠️ Внимание: Никогда не пытайтесь редактировать поврежденный файл в исходном формате без предварительного создания резервной копии. Любое действие может окончательно разрушить структуру данных.

Сбои в работе временных файлов и кэша

Процесс сохранения в Excel тесно связан с созданием временных файлов, которые хранятся в системных папках. Если папка для временных файлов переполнена, имеет ограничения по правам доступа или повреждена, программа не сможет создать необходимый буфер для операции записи. Очистка временных файлов часто решает проблему «залипания» сохранения.

Для очистки необходимо закрыть все программы Office и удалить содержимое папок, путь к которым можно найти в настройках системы или через команду выполнения %temp%. Также стоит проверить настройки самого Excel в разделе «Файл» → «Параметры» → «Сохранение», где указывается путь к папке автовосстановления. Убедитесь, что этот путь действителен и диск не переполнен.

Устаревшая версия программы и драйверов

Иногда причина кроется в несовместимости установленной версии офисного пакета с текущей операционной системой или драйверами принтера (да, драйверы принтера влияют на рендеринг страниц в Excel). Если вы используете старую версию, например, Excel 2010 на Windows 11, могут возникать системные конфликты. Регулярное обновление продукта через центр обновлений Microsoft устраняет известные баги.

Также стоит проверить наличие обновлений для Windows, так как системные библиотеки, необходимые для работы офисных приложений, могут быть повреждены или устареть. Переустановка офисного пакета с полным удалением старых компонентов часто является радикальным, но действенным методом решения комплексных проблем.

Почему Excel предлагает сохранить файл как «Только для чтения»?

Это происходит, если файл открыт другим пользователем, расположен в защищенной системной папке, имеет атрибут «Только для чтения» в свойствах Windows или если программа обнаружила потенциальные проблемы с файлом и блокирует запись во избежание потери данных.

Как восстановить несохраненный документ после сбоя?

Перейдите в меню «Файл» → «Сведения» → «Управление документом» → «Восстановить несохраненные книги». Также можно поискать файлы с расширением .asd в папке автосохранения, путь к которой указан в параметрах Excel.

Может ли антивирус блокировать сохранение в Excel?

Да, некоторые антивирусные программы могут считать макросы или активные скрипты в Excel угрозами и блокировать запись изменений на диск. Попробуйте добавить файл или папку в исключения антивируса для проверки.

Что делать, если файл сохраняется, но данные в него не записываются?

Скорее всего, вы работаете с копией файла или файл заблокирован. Проверьте заголовок окна программы — если там есть слово «[Только для чтения]» или «[Совместимый режим]», используйте функцию «Сохранить как» для создания новой рабочей копии.